A collection of 4 worksheets on set language and notation based on the GCSE 9-1 specification. The following are included: An introductory worksheet on sets. The exercises require to list the elements of a described set, to describe a set given its elements and to use the symbols for belongs to and does not belong to. A worksheet on set notation: belongs to, does not belong to, union, intersection, empty set, complement of a set, number of elements of a set etc. A worksheet on the union and intersection of two or more sets and the complement of a set. A worksheet on Venn diagrams and set notation ( the symbols for belongs/ does not belong to, union and intersection, empty set, complement of a set, number of elements of a set). Detailed solutions are included.
